#12442d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#12442d is composed of 7.1% red, 26.7% green and 17.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 33.8% yellow and 73.3% black. It has a hue angle of 152.4 degrees, a saturation of 58.1% and a lightness of 16.9%. #12442d color hex could be obtained by blending #24885a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

Shades and Tints of #12442d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020604 is the darkest color, while #f5fcf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#12442d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#292d2b is the less saturated color, while #01552e is the most saturated one.
